  • Domestic vs. Imported Silicone Oil: Is the Gap Really About Quality—or Just Ingrained Perception?

    For years, “imported silicone oil is more stable” has been the default assumption among many high-end manufacturers. But as China’s organosilicon industry upgrades its entire supply chain, this belief is being challenged. Recent comparative data show that leading domestic silicone oils now match—and in some cases surpass—international brands in key metrics such as metal ion content, color (APHA), and acid value, while offering 30% lower pricing on average and delivery lead times reduced by over 50%.
    “We can also achieve ppm-level control,” says a technical director at a leading Chinese high-purity silicone oil producer. Take electronic-grade dimethicone as an example: their product features total metal ions (Fe, Na, K, etc.) <5 ppm, color <20 APHA, and acid value <0.05 mg KOH/g—performance virtually identical to that of a well-known German brand in side-by-side testing. Moreover, through real-time viscosity monitoring and closed-loop GPC-based molecular weight distribution control, top-tier domestic manufacturers have tightened viscosity tolerance to ±3%, far exceeding the industry norm of ±10%.
    The real difference may no longer lie in the product itself—but in technical service responsiveness.
    “A few years ago, ordering imported material meant waiting six weeks,” admits a procurement manager at a new energy battery manufacturer. “Now, domestic suppliers can ship samples within 48 hours and deliver bulk orders in seven days. Our production line downtime risk has dropped dramatically.”
    Especially in impurity-sensitive applications—such as thermal greases, cosmetics, and pharmaceutical excipients—Chinese suppliers are shifting from merely “selling raw materials” to “providing integrated solutions.” This includes:
    • Customizing narrow-distribution silicone oils
    • Supplying GC-MS/ICP-MS analytical reports
    • Co-developing compatibility tests with customers
    “We don’t just deliver product—we actively participate in formulation optimization,” the technical director adds.
    That said, not all domestic silicone oils meet this standard. Industry experts caution buyers to verify whether a supplier possesses:
    • High-vacuum devolatilization and precision fractional distillation capabilities
    • robust quality control system (e.g., ISO/IEC 17025-accredited lab)
    • Relevant compliance certifications (REACH, USP, FDA, etc.)
    “The ‘imported halo’ is fading,” summarizes a veteran formulator. “When domestic options consistently deliver on performance, cost, and agility, the rational choice becomes obvious.”
    Amid the broader trend toward supply chain autonomy in high-end manufacturing, Chinese silicone oil is evolving from a “substitute option” into the preferred solution—not through price dumping, but through molecular-level precision and granular, responsive service.
